Working in our team you will:
Think creatively to find optimal solutions to our complex, often ambiguous problems
Participate in all stages of developing and serving new platforms for various AI solutions and improving existing Snowflake’s functionalities in the AI domain
Work closely with other research, engineering, and business teams to understand and shape the short and long-term product development strategy
Serve as a mentor to less experienced engineers, researchers, and product managers
4+ years of experience writing production-quality scalable code using backend languages (preferred Go, Java, C++, Python)
BSc in a technical field (AI/ML, CS, DS, Physics, Math, etc), MSc/PhD is a plus
Professional level in building SDKs / web service APIs (REST/ gRPC)
Experience with software engineering best practices (programming, testing, version control, CI/CD, docker/Kubernetes, Jenkins, agile development, etc)
High levels of curiosity and eager enthusiasm for open-ended problems. Experience and interest in problem formulation based on relatively abstract information
Ability to articulate results and complex concepts to leadership
Must be able to produce solutions independently in an organized manner, work in a team, and also be able to lead a team when required
Hands-on experience in the MLOps field (e.g., deploying ML models) will be a strong asset.

Snowflake is a cloud-based data platform that enables organizations to store, manage, and analyze data at scale. The company provides solutions for data warehousing, data lakes, data engineering, and AI/ML workloads across major cloud providers.
